
The Drop 074 | Brittany Charboneau, The North Face Athlete & Dopey Challenge Champion
Jan 28, 2022
Join the fun as they chat with The North Face runner, Brittany Charboneau, who conquered Disney's Dopey Challenge. From Winter GRIT training to gluten-free breadcrumbs, they cover marathon prep, dealing with injury, and more. Dive into the dynamic conversations about funny running stories, race day excitement, and the journey from amateur to elite. Hear about Brittany's passion for running, comedy, and custom shoe designs. Plus, get insights on mental challenges in races, recovery tools, and sponsorship by The North Face.
